Golden
Gate N Back - $75
This memorable trip starts at
Sea Trek's beach location in Sausalito.
We'll begin on the beach with
a thorough safety orientation
and instruction session, then
launch for a leisurely paddle
along the Sausalito waterfront
towards the Golden Gate. The winds
and currents will determine how
close we get to the Gate. This
is a magnificent way to experience
the Bay offering dramatic views
of the Golden Gate Bridge, the
San Francisco skyline and Angel
Island.
How
does this paddle differ from the
Paddle the Gate? We meet at Sea
Trek in Sausalito and not below
the north end of the bridge. It
involves more paddling and is
one hour longer. We do not go
out the bridge and along the Marin
coast as part of this paddle.
We stay inside the bay. This paddle
offers greater flexibility in
terms of when it can be run because
it is not highly current dependent
like the Paddle the Gate.
Time:
4 hours
Cost:
$75
Experience
Level: Apppropriate for beginners
who lead a physically active lifestyle. |
